What does it look like

Kyoso is one of the manufacturers of radio-controlled toys.They actively promote their products, surprising with an unexpected approach to everyday things. To help the housewives, resourceful Japanese came up with the idea of ​​screwing the chassis from a radio-controlled machine to a long-bristled brush. Comes with a joystick, it launches a brush. Now you can remove dust without getting up from your favorite sofa! The remote control will send a miracle thing on a trip around the apartment, and its compact size will allow it to climb under a bed or sofa with high legs. A mop will help sweep all the debris into a pile.

I found one more interesting thing on the radio control - the bin. Perhaps the dream of many people has come true! No need to get up to throw a pile of accumulated bits and candy wrappers, it’s clever enough to control the joystick, and the garbage bucket will arrive on its own.

Advantages and disadvantages of the invention

What can a miracle mop?

  1. It well sweeps away dust, is able to eliminate accidentally spilled water.
  2. The relatively small size will allow her to maneuver in various situations, to climb under furniture.
  3. Cleaning will occur without unnecessary energy. The mopman just needs to lie and control.
  4. The price is several times different from the cost of the robot vacuum cleaner! If we compare, it turns out that instead of one robot of average parameters, you can buy about 4-5 Japanese radio-controlled mops!

It seems everything is wonderful: you lie, but they clean up for you! But then there are many questions that are disappointing answers:

  1. Compactness will increase cleaning time. In my opinion, an ordinary large mop removes dirt faster. Although, perhaps, over time, we will reach the heights of this art and begin to do the cleaning at the master level.
  2. We must learn to use the remote control. It resembles a joystick from game consoles. If manual cleaning is familiar to each of us since childhood, then we need to sit and figure it out so as not to complicate our lives, instead of cleaning, scattering garbage throughout the apartment.
  3. For ease of operation, they lose a lot to the robot vacuum cleaner, taking an incomprehensible position somewhere between a broom and the last word of technology.
  4. I’m a little disappointed: I still have to get up from the sofa! Garbage does not fall into the bucket by itself, even if it is also on automatic wheels. To buy or not? That is the question

Japanese inventors have long thundered to the whole world with their absurd genius. They even have in their language such a thing as “chindogu”, meaning a useful, but deliberately ridiculous invention. Radio-controlled mop refers to such new products that are incomprehensible to people. For example, I found a lot on Amazon with a price of $ 37.45 and only three reviews - all with a touch of slight bewilderment and negativity.

I think that such a mop has one really useful application - to remain a toy and teach children how to keep clean. Let the annoying process turn into an exciting game!
